Role: SENDCo
Place of work: St Leonard’s C of E Primary School, Exeter
Contract Term: Permanent full time
Salary: MPS – UPS (Up to UPS3)
Anticipated Start Date: January 2026; earlier if possible
Closing Date: 12pm Thursday 19th June 2025
Interview Date: Tuesday 1st July
St Leonard's C of E Primary School is excited to announce that we are seeking to appoint a full-time SENDCo to join our Leadership Team. This post is full-time and non-teaching in a busy thriving school community where we strive to enable all children to make good progress and encounter memorable learning experiences.
If you have a genuine passion for supporting children with SEND, co-ordinating best practice provision, liaising sensitively with parents, communicating effectively with other professionals, and advising teachers on best practices – then we want to hear from you!
St Leonard’s can promise you an Ofsted Outstanding Leadership Team, who are committed to long term, sustainable change to improve the provision, standards and outcomes for pupils. We want all doors to be open to our children, regardless of their background or barriers that they face, and we strive to be a beacon for our community, as recognised by an Outstanding Personal Development judgement. The successful candidate will help shape the future innovation and development of our school going forward.
We offer:
· A genuine and friendly school with a strong Christian ethos and set of values that underpin all that we do
· Exceptional children who are articulate, happy and motivated to learn
· A happy, stable staffing team
· A proven track record of developing ECTs into excellent middle leaders
· A headteacher who puts children at the heart of all decision making
· Unique and bespoke facilities to deliver an outstanding curriculum, such as: Tardis-like grounds, a Computing Suite, a newly developed Library and a fully fitted Cookery Hive
· Research-driven CPD specifically tailored to our school’s needs
· Opportunities for future career development across our family of 21 schools within the St Christopher’s Trust
The successful candidate will:
· Be emotionally intelligent and ambitious for all
· Have the ability to enable pupils to reach their full social and academic potential, underpinned by a strong personal philosophy
· Be dedicated to raising standards and removing barriers to learning for pupils with the ability to challenge each pupil from whatever their starting point
· Strong subject and pedagogical knowledge
· Be happy to support the Church of England ethos of our school though our school values
